In today’s fast-paced business world, staying on top of your finances requires more than just a spreadsheet and a filing cabinet. Modern businesses rely on digital tools to streamline accounting, improve accuracy, and gain real-time insights into their financial health. Here’s a rundown of the essential digital tools every business should consider.


1. Cloud Accounting Software

Cloud-based accounting platforms, like Xero, allow businesses to manage their finances anytime, anywhere. They automate bookkeeping tasks, integrate with bank accounts, and provide real-time dashboards showing your cash flow, expenses, and profits. For SMEs, cloud software is the backbone of efficient, accurate accounting.


2. Expense Management Tools

Managing receipts and expenses can be time-consuming, but digital tools like Hubdoc and Receipt Bank (DEXT) simplify the process. These apps allow you to scan and categorise receipts, track employee expenses, and generate reports — all automatically syncing with your accounting software.


3. Invoicing and Payment Platforms

Tools such as Stripe, GoCardless, or PayPal help businesses send professional invoices and collect payments quickly. Many integrate directly with accounting software, ensuring your accounts are updated automatically. Faster invoicing means faster payments and better cash flow management.


4. Payroll and HR Solutions

Managing payroll doesn’t have to be a headache. Solutions Xero Payroll streamline salary calculations, tax deductions, and statutory reporting. They also help manage employee records, leave, and benefits, keeping everything compliant and efficient.


5. Financial Analytics and Reporting Tools

Data is power, and tools like Xero turn your raw financial data into actionable insights. They allow businesses to forecast growth, track key performance indicators, and make strategic decisions backed by accurate data.


6. Document Storage & Collaboration Tools

Secure digital storage platforms, such as Google Drive, Dropbox, or ShareFile, ensure all your financial documents are safely stored and easily accessible. Coupled with collaboration tools like Slack or Microsoft Teams, they make it simple for your team and your accountant to work together seamlessly.
